Why Most Platforms Resist Systems

Beyond randomness, most crypto platforms have a second problem: accounts. An account can be suspended. Verification can be requested at any moment. Withdrawals can be delayed or blocked. Even when a platform is not designed to be unreliable, it becomes unreliable in practice when the control layer can activate at any time. A participant cannot build a repeatable daily habit around something that might stop working because a flag was triggered in a system they do not control.

On-chain Bitcoin competition removes both problems structurally. No randomness in the outcome mechanism — the leaderboard ranks by committed BTC, and the address with the highest confirmed total holds first place. No account layer — participation is a Bitcoin transaction; there is no account to suspend, no verification to trigger, no platform decision standing between the transaction and the leaderboard position. When a round ends, prizes go directly to winning Bitcoin addresses as on-chain transactions. Not to a platform balance. Not to a withdrawal queue. To the addresses — recorded on the blockchain, verifiable by anyone, outside any platform's ability to modify after confirmation.

What Systematic Daily Participation Actually Looks Like

A participant who approaches on-chain competition as a systematic practice has a different process from the start than one who treats each round as an isolated bet. The systematic participant reads the leaderboard before entering — checking what positions exist, what the gaps are, and whether the current competitive field makes participation worthwhile. They size entries within a pre-set framework (maximum per-round allocation, competition reserve — see the related Bitok Arena analysis on risk management). They note round conditions that produced different outcomes and adjust their approach accordingly over time.

This is a different posture than placing a bet and waiting. It resembles something closer to a daily competitive task — one that requires attention, consistency, and judgment, and rewards those things over time as accumulated round experience builds understanding of how the leaderboard actually behaves across different competitive conditions.
